The evolution of medical staff credentialing
Summary

Area of Science:
- Healthcare Administration
- Medical Staff Management
- Quality Improvement
Background:
- The increasing commercialization of medicine necessitates formal processes for verifying physician qualifications.
- Physician practice is now contingent upon affiliation with healthcare entities.
- Healthcare organizations require robust mechanisms to ensure patient care quality and operational efficiency.
Purpose of the Study:
- To examine the evolution of medical staff credentialing processes.
- To understand the current state of credentialing mechanisms.
- To forecast future trends in credentialing.
Main Methods:
- Analysis of the historical development of medical staff credentialing.
- Review of current credentialing practices and their underlying principles.
- Discussion of factors influencing the future of credentialing.
Main Results:
- Credentialing has transformed from a simple verification to a complex process.
- Current credentialing integrates quality assurance and efficiency mandates.
- The business aspect of healthcare significantly shapes credentialing.
Conclusions:
- Medical staff credentialing is a dynamic process adapting to healthcare's business evolution.
- Future credentialing will likely involve more sophisticated methods for quality and efficiency.
- Understanding these mechanisms is crucial for healthcare entities and practitioners.
